Kota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Kota Village has a population of 19 (19) with 6 (6) males and 13 (13) females.The sex ratio in Kota is 2167,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Note : In the 2011 Census, Kota village is listed as part of the Lansdowne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Garhwal District in the state of UTTARAKHAND in INDIA.

Kota Literacy Rate
Kota Village has a literacy rate of 94.44% which is higher than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Kota Village is 100 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Kota Village is 91.67 higher than national average of 64.63%.
